http://www.nzherald.co.nz/world/news/article.cfm?c_id=2&objectid=11650717 Geophysicist Ian Hamling said that since 1950, enough magma to fill 80,000 Olympic-size swimming pools has squeezed up beneath the surface near the coastal town of Matata, about 200 kilometers (120 miles) southeast of Auckland. A paper published Saturday in the online journal Science Advances outlines the findings. Hamling,Continue Reading
